Patent number: 9993867Abstract: Provided is a high-pressure casting method and a high-pressure casting device which are capable of safe and high-quality casting of a high-fusion-point metal having a fusion point exceeding 1000 K. After melting a casting material (1) inside a melting container (2) of cartridge type, the melting container (2) is linearly moved to pass through a guide (14) attached to a casting port bush (13) to thereby be communicated with the casting port bush (13). The melting container (2) is brought into close contact with the guide (14) and is setting to a cooling state. After the elapse of prescribed time, a plunger (50) is brought into contact with a plunger tip (4), and is immediately transferred together with a molten metal to the casting port bush (13). The molten metal is pressurized inside the casting port bush (13), and is injection-filled into a cavity (10).Type: GrantFiled: January 5, 2015Date of Patent: June 12, 2018Assignee: FUKUI PREFECTURAL GOVERNMENTInventor: Koichi Tomita

Patent number: 7967182Abstract: Provided is a dissimilar metal joint product of nickel-titanium alloy material and pure titanium material, having a tensile strength at the joint not less than that of the pure titanium material before joining, having a small variation in the strength at the joint, and having narrow heat-affected zone after joining, and a method for joining thereof. A round rod 1 of the nickel-titanium alloy material is integrally joined with a round rod 2 of the pure titanium material, while rotating at least one of the joining faces for conducting frictional pressure welding, applying a specified upset force thereto to compress thereof, after the start of deceleration of the rotation, in a period where peripheral velocity in the outermost periphery of the rotation in the joining face is not less than 0.5 m/sec. A reaction layer structure is formed at the joint by the compressive force induced by the upset force and by the rotational force of decelerating rotation.Type: GrantFiled: March 28, 2008Date of Patent: June 28, 2011Assignee: Fukui Prefectural GovernmentInventors: Makoto Nojiri, Koichi Tomita
